Types of Welding Qualifications
Despite the fact that the American Welding Society’s standard CW card paves the way for most positions, specific fields call for their own specific certificate. Several of the most-popular of them are highlighted below.
- ASME Certification for those who deal with boiler and pressure containers
- Certified Welder Certification to become a Certified Welder
- American Petroleum Institute Certification for those that work with pipelines in the gas and oil field
- SCWI and CWI Certifications for inspectors and senior inspectors

The data shows salary and labor forecasts for welders in the State of California through 2022.
California | Employment | |||
---|---|---|---|---|
2012 | 2022 | Change | Annual Job Openings | |
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ers | 24,700 | 26,300 | 7% | 770 |
California | Annual Salary | ||
---|---|---|---|
Low | Median | High | |
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ers |
$23,900 | $38,600 | $65,600 |
Source: O*Net Online

Before you register for a welder training school, it’s best to verify that the welding specialist training course is currently approved by the AWS. If the accreditation status is good, you may want to have a look at some other features of the program in contrast with other training programs providing the exact same education.
- Make certain that the college’s curriculum features courses in SMAW, GMAW, GTAW and pipe welding
- Choose institutions that cover AWS SENSE standards
- Learn if the college offers financial assistance
- Make certain the college trains on gear that satisfies existing industry standards
